Table 1 Relative importance of different interaction properties on recipient population sensitivity to the insecticide treatment (a, I vs. C), the herbicide treatment (b, H vs. C), and the insecticide + herbicide treatment (c, I + H vs. C)
(a) I vs. C | |||
---|---|---|---|
likelihood ratio χ2 | df | P | |
Mean interaction strength | 0.28 | 1 | 0.59 |
Interaction temporal variability | 26.78 | 1 | <0.001 |
Interaction density-dependence (IDD) | 0.35 | 1 | 0.55 |
Direction of IDD (negative or positive) | 0.03 | 1 | 0.86 |
IDD × direction of IDD | 0.41 | 1 | 0.52 |
Recipient function | 2.88 | 2 | 0.24 |
(b) H vs. C | |||
---|---|---|---|
likelihood ratio χ2 | df | P | |
Mean interaction strength | 0.25 | 1 | 0.62 |
Interaction temporal variability | 7.62 | 1 | 0.01 |
Interaction density-dependence (IDD) | 0.68 | 1 | 0.41 |
Direction of IDD (negative or positive) | 0.07 | 1 | 0.8 |
IDD × direction of IDD | 1.06 | 1 | 0.3 |
Recipient function | 1.23 | 2 | 0.54 |
(c) I + H vs. C | |||
---|---|---|---|
likelihood ratio χ2 | df | P | |
Mean interaction strength | 0.01 | 1 | 0.92 |
Interaction temporal variability | 21.9 | 1 | <0.001 |
Interaction density-dependence (IDD) | 1.61 | 1 | 0.21 |
Direction of IDD (negative or positive) | 0.12 | 1 | 0.73 |
IDD × direction of IDD | 7.5 | 1 | 0.01 |
Recipient function | 9.96 | 2 | 0.01 |
